Partager via


SPIisWebSite.ServerState - Propriété

Obtient une valeur qui décrit l'état du serveur.

Espace de noms :  Microsoft.SharePoint.Administration
Assembly :  Microsoft.SharePoint (dans Microsoft.SharePoint.dll)

Syntaxe

'Déclaration
Public ReadOnly Property ServerState As SPIisWebSite.SPIisServerState
    Get
'Utilisation
Dim instance As SPIisWebSite
Dim value As SPIisWebSite.SPIisServerState

value = instance.ServerState
public SPIisWebSite.SPIisServerState ServerState { get; }

Valeur de propriété

Type : Microsoft.SharePoint.Administration.SPIisWebSite.SPIisServerState
Une valeur SPIisWebSite.SPIisServerState qui décrit l'état du serveur.

Remarques

Cette propriété spécifie l'état du serveur ; Si le serveur n'est pas encore dans cet état, la mise en oeuvre entraîne le serveur à modifier l'état.

Exemples

Le code suivant affiche l'état du serveur de la batterie de serveurs locale SharePoint Foundation

[C#]

SPSite oSiteCollection = new SPSite("https://localhost");
string strNewName;
Uri uri = new Uri(oSiteCollection.Url); 
SPWebApplication webApp = SPWebApplication.Lookup(uri);
int instID = webApp.IisSettings[SPUrlZone.Default].PreferredInstanceId;
SPIisWebSite iisWebSite = new SPIisWebSite(instID);
Console.WriteLine("*>>> SPIISWebsite Instance Id " + iisWebSite.InstanceId);
Console.WriteLine("*>>> Server State             " + iisWebSite.ServerState);

Voir aussi

Référence

SPIisWebSite classe

SPIisWebSite - Membres

Microsoft.SharePoint.Administration - Espace de noms